[PATCH v3 11/25] video: Enable VIDEO_ANSI by default only with EFI
    Simon Glass 
    sjg at chromium.org
       
    Fri Jan  6 15:52:29 CET 2023
    
    
  
This is not generally needed unless EFI_LOADER is used. Adjust the default
setting to reduce the size of the U-Boot build.
